Administration Officer INR 20.000 - INR 25.000 Per Month Poonamallee, Tamil Nadu Sarvajith Infotech 6 months ago
Motion Graphic Designer INR 20.000 - INR 40.000 Per Month Adambakkam, Tamil Nadu Orange Digital Marketing 5 months ago